- The distance between Quito, Ecuador and Williston, North Dakota, Usa is approximately 5,897 km or 3,664 mi.
- To reach Quito in this distance one would set out from Williston, North Dakota bearing 147.9°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Quito bearing 159.2° or SSE .
- Quito has a subtropical highland climate with no dry season (Cfb) whereas Williston, North Dakota has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Quito is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Williston, North Dakota is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average temperature is 9.1 °C (16.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 33.3 °C (59.9°F) less in Quito.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 666.6 mm (26.2 in) more which is equivalent to 666.6 l/m² (16.36 US gal/ft²) or 6,666,000 l/ha (712,640 US gal/ac) more. About 3 as much.
- There are 730 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Quito. In whichever way circa 1h 59' less per day or about 3/4 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 32.8° higher in Quito than in Williston, North Dakota.
- Relative humidity levels are 19.3%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 13°C (23.4°F) higher.
